2. Horizon Fitness T101 Treadmill

The T101 treadmill by Horizon Fitness is a budget-friendly model that is affordable. It comes with a 2.5 CHP engine that can reach speeds up to 10 mph and an adjustable incline that can be as high as 10%. It's an excellent option for runners looking to add variety to their training. The running surface measures 20 inches wide and 55 inches long, which allows the majority of people to walk on and perform other exercises like side shuffles.

Unlike other treadmills, the T101 comes with QuickDial controls at the edges of each handrail that allow you to manage the speed and the incline. Simply move the dials forward to increase your speed or reverse to slow your speed. This allows you to alter direction and control your speed more easily than using buttons on an instrument console. The treadmill is also fitted with pulse sensors on the handrails that monitor your heart rate. We recommend using a chest belt to get the most accurate results.

This treadmill features a simple, easy-to-use interface with nine pre-programmed workouts to aid you in reaching your fitness goals. You can also enjoy your favourite music through the built-in speakers or view an upcoming movie on the screen while working out. You can connect your tablet or smartphone to the treadmill to stream fitness classes and apps like Peloton.

When shopping for a new treadmill, you must also consider the warranty. Many manufacturers offer different lengths of coverage for different parts, so it's important to go over the fine print to make sure that you're happy with the terms. The T101 is protected by a lifetime frame and motor warranties, which are the best for its price.

This is a great option for those who are looking for a compact, inexpensive model to add to home gyms. This treadmill can handle up to 300 pounds, which is sufficient for the majority of people beginning out or for moderately-sized joggers. Its hydraulic folding design is also very convenient it allows users to fold it and store it easily between use.

3. Sole F80 Treadmill

The F80 is a fantastic treadmill for those who want to add some modern features to their home fitness center without breaking the bank. The F80 is an affordable treadmill that has a 3.5 HP engine and foldable design. It has everything you need to get an excellent workout. The 10.1-inch touchscreen comes preloaded with seven apps which include YouTube, Netflix, ESPN, and various news apps. Screen mirroring is also possible to put your phone onto the console to watch the latest TV show or film while you work out. There are also Bluetooth speakers so you can skip the earbuds and enjoy your workout while listening to music.

The Sole F80 has built-in fans that are located above the console. This will give you a nice breeze as you work out. This is helpful for runners or someone who gets hot easily while exercising. Sole Fitness also offers a smartphone app that allows you to track your progress. The app provides thousands of workouts as well as professional advice from top trainers. There is a holder for devices that fits most electronics above the console if you want to connect a smartphone or tablet.

Cushioning is another great feature of the Sole F80. It helps reduce the force on joints during exercise. The Cushion Flex Whisper Deck used by the Sole F80 is 40 percent more absorbent than running over pavement. This helps prevent joint pain or injury, and will make your workouts more enjoyable and comfortable.

This treadmill comes with a guarantee that is better than many other brands. Sole Fitness offers a lifetime warranty on the motor and frame of this treadmill, and five-year warranties on the electronic parts and components. The company also provides two-year labor warranty which is higher than average for this price range.

The Sole F80 weighs 278 pounds. It's not the best choice for those with limited small space treadmill with incline. However, it does come with four wheels, which makes moving it much easier.
